#include <sys/types.h>
#include <sys/stat.h>
#include <sys/file.h>
#include <sys/param.h>
#include <fcntl.h>
#include <unistd.h>
#include <stdio.h>
#include <errno.h>
#include <sys/sysmacros.h>
#include <string.h> /* memset, strerror */
#include "file_lock.h"
#ifndef EFSEXCLWR
#define EFSEXCLWR 503
#endif
/*
* String containing the last system call.
*
*/
char Fl_syscall_str[128];
static char errmsg[256];
/***********************************************************************
*
* Test interface to the fcntl system call.
* It will loop if the LOCK_NB flags is NOT set.
***********************************************************************/
int
file_lock(fd, flags, errormsg)
int fd;
int flags;
char **errormsg;
{
register int cmd, ret;
struct flock flocks;
memset(&flocks, 0, sizeof(struct flock));
if (flags&LOCK_NB)
cmd = F_SETLK;
else
cmd = F_SETLKW;
flocks.l_whence = 0;
flocks.l_start = 0;
flocks.l_len = 0;
if (flags&LOCK_UN)
flocks.l_type = F_UNLCK;
else if (flags&LOCK_EX)
flocks.l_type = F_WRLCK;
else if (flags&LOCK_SH)
flocks.l_type = F_RDLCK;
else {
errno = EINVAL;
if ( errormsg != NULL ) {
sprintf(errmsg,
"Programmer error, called file_lock with in valid flags\n");
*errormsg = errmsg;
}
return -1;
}
sprintf(Fl_syscall_str,
"fcntl(%d, %d, &flocks): type:%d whence:%d, start:%lld len:%lld\n",
fd, cmd, flocks.l_type, flocks.l_whence,
(long long)flocks.l_start, (long long)flocks.l_len);
while (1) {
ret = fcntl(fd, cmd, &flocks);
if ( ret < 0 ) {
if ( cmd == F_SETLK )
switch (errno) {
/* these errors are okay */
case EACCES: /* Permission denied */
case EINTR: /* interrupted system call */
#ifdef EFILESH
case EFILESH: /* file shared */
#endif
case EFSEXCLWR: /* File is write protected */
continue; /* retry getting lock */
}
if ( errormsg != NULL ) {
sprintf(errmsg, "fcntl(%d, %d, &flocks): errno:%d %s\n",
fd, cmd, errno, strerror(errno));
*errormsg = errmsg;
}
return -1;
}
break;
}
return ret;
} /* end of file_lock */
